用WinCC脚本通迅触摸屏

at 2024.10.01 12:31  ca 设备销售区  pv 904  by 工控设备哥  

🔥用WinCC脚本通讯触摸屏,解锁工控新技能!🔥

工控们!👋今天我要给大家分享一个实用的技巧——用WinCC脚本通讯触摸屏。相信很多从事工控领域的都对WinCC不陌生,而触摸屏作为工控系统的重要组成部分,掌握其通讯技巧对我们的工作可是大有裨益哦!🎉

一、WinCC简介

WinCC是西门子推出的一款工业自动化组态软件,广泛应用于PLC、HMI、SCADA等领域。它具备强大的图形化组态功能和丰富的通讯接口,可以帮助我们轻松实现工控系统的搭建和优化。

二、触摸屏通讯原理

触摸屏通讯主要分为两种方式:串口通讯和以太网通讯。下面我们以串口通讯为例,来讲解一下如何用WinCC脚本实现触摸屏通讯。

1. 创建串口通讯对象

在WinCC项目中,我们需要创建一个串口通讯对象。具体操作如下:

(1)打开WinCC项目,选择“设备与接口”选项卡。

图片 用WinCC脚本通迅触摸屏2

(2)右键点击“串口”,选择“创建串口”。

(3)在弹出的对话框中,设置串口号、波特率、数据位、停止位、校验位等参数。

2. 编写WinCC脚本

图片 用WinCC脚本通迅触摸屏

接下来,我们需要编写WinCC脚本来实现触摸屏与PLC的通讯。以下是一个简单的例子:

```

// 读取PLC的某个变量

Dim var As Variant

var = ReadTag("PLC:Tag1")

// 将变量显示在触摸屏上

SetTag("HMI:Tag1", var)

```

在上面的脚本中,我们首先使用`ReadTag`函数读取PLC中的变量,然后使用`SetTag`函数将变量值显示在触摸屏上。

3. 设置触摸屏参数

在触摸屏上,我们需要设置相应的参数,以便正确接收和处理PLC发送的数据。具体操作如下:

(1)打开触摸屏项目,选择“对象”选项卡。

(2)右键点击“变量”,选择“创建变量”。

(3)在弹出的对话框中,设置变量类型、数据类型、名称等参数。

(4)将创建的变量与PLC中的变量进行关联。

三、

我们就可以实现WinCC脚本与触摸屏的通讯了。掌握这项技能,可以帮助我们更高效地完成工控系统搭建和优化工作。🎯

以下是一些关于WinCC脚本通讯触摸屏的注意事项:

1. 确保串口参数与PLC一致。

2. 在编写脚本时,注意检查变量类型和数据类型是否匹配。

3. 定期检查触摸屏与PLC的通讯状态,确保数据传输稳定。

4. 针对不同的工控项目,灵活运用WinCC脚本,提高工作效率。

用WinCC脚本通讯触摸屏是一项实用的技能,希望这篇文章能对大家有所帮助。祝大家在工控领域越走越远!🚀🎉

相关阅读